      New Language in Dreams

      So last night I had a non-lucid dream that I was in someplace far away from home (how far or where exactly I don't know, but I was staying in a hotel, and DC's told me I was far away from home). At first everyone was speaking English, but then one time as I was walking out of the hotel building, a DC opened the door for me as he walked in. I said 'thank you', only in a very different language than English. I'm not sure how the words I said would be spelled, so I won't try.

      But then the interesting thing was, this DC understood me. And when I walked out of the building and over to where a group of my friends were standing, I told them about what had happened, and they all understood the words, too. Upon realizing this, we all started to just talk in this non-existent language that I had created, and we could all understand each other 100%, and the words consistently meant the same things!


      Now, I can understand how we'd be able to understand each other, since all that really mattered was that my brain knew what each person was supposed to be saying, but the consistency of everything really surprised me. I'm not even multi-lingual IRL...so I'm very surprised that my mind would just spontaneously create an entirely original language with its own word order and grammar and everything. But I know it did, because the surprise that I had in the dream was enough to make me consciously pay attention, even though I wasn't aware of the fact that I was dreaming. Of course I no longer remember the language now that I've woken up, and it's really too bad...it sounded neat

      What about you guys? Have you come up with an entire language in your dreams before?
